A quartet of American business students has taken to the Kickstarter crowdfunding platform to promote a new summer line of menswear.
Dubbed the RompHim, the one-piece shirt-and-shorts combo mimics rompers typically worn by ladies, but with a zippered fly and adjustable waistband meant to make the garment more comfortable for men.
The project was created by Illinois-based ACED Design, made up of four business students from Northwestern University.
The Kickstarter campaign includes a video featuring men strutting their stuff in what the company writes may be “…the start of a fashion revolution.”
While the garment may appear unconventional to some, there’s clearly a demand out there — at time of writing, the campaign had smashed its $10,000 goal by raising over $125,000.
